How Many Samples Do You Actually Need?

More isn’t always better—request the right number for thorough evaluation without waste. 🔢

For most applications, 2-3 sample units provide optimal validation: one for dimensional verification and installation testing (non-destructive), one for performance and endurance testing (potentially destructive), and optionally one for backup or parallel testing. Single samples are risky because you cannot perform destructive testing while preserving a unit for installation trials. Requesting 5+ samples without clear justification may signal you’re not a serious buyer or planning to reverse-engineer the product. For large projects (500+ units) or critical applications (aerospace, medical), 3-5 samples are reasonable. Bepto typically recommends 2 samples for standard applications and 3 for custom or high-value projects, with clear testing protocols for each unit.

How to Allocate Multiple Samples

Two-Sample Strategy:

  • Sample #1: Dimensional verification, installation fit-check, short-term performance testing (preserve for reference)
  • Sample #2: Accelerated life testing, destructive examination if needed, seal compatibility testing

Three-Sample Strategy:

  • Sample #1: Dimensional verification and documentation (archive as reference standard)
  • Sample #2: Installation and integration testing in actual application
  • Sample #3: Accelerated durability testing, potentially to failure

When to Request More:

  • Multiple operating conditions to test (different pressures, temperatures, media)
  • Parallel evaluation by different teams or facilities
  • Long-term field trials while lab testing continues
  • Need to preserve samples for regulatory approval documentation

What Testing Should You Perform on Samples?

Thorough testing reveals whether samples truly represent production quality and meet your needs. 🔬

Comprehensive sample testing should include: dimensional verification using calibrated measuring instruments (calipers, micrometers) comparing actual to specified dimensions with tolerances, visual inspection for finish quality, weld integrity, and workmanship, functional testing at your operating pressure verifying force output and smooth operation, installation trials confirming mounting compatibility and port accessibility, seal integrity testing checking for internal and external leakage, accelerated life testing running 10,000-100,000+ cycles to predict long-term reliability, and documentation review verifying certifications, test reports, and material certificates match claims. Comprehensive Testing Protocol

Here’s a systematic approach to sample evaluation:

Phase 1: Initial Inspection (Day 1)

✅ Packaging Assessment:

  • Evaluate packaging quality (indicates attention to detail)
  • Check for shipping damage
  • Verify contents match packing list

✅ Visual Inspection:

  • Surface finish and coating quality
  • Weld and joint integrity
  • Labeling and identification marks
  • Overall workmanship

✅ Documentation Review:

  • Dimensional drawings
  • Material certificates
  • Test reports (pressure testing, leak testing)
  • Certifications (ISO, CE, etc.)

Phase 2: Dimensional Verification (Day 1-2)

MeasurementToolToleranceCritical?
Bore diameterInternal micrometer±0.1mmYes
Stroke lengthCaliper/ruler±1mmYes
Mounting hole spacingCaliper±0.2mmYes
Port thread sizeThread gaugeExact matchYes
Overall lengthCaliper±2mmModerate
Rod diameter (if applicable)Micrometer±0.05mmYes

Phase 3: Functional Testing (Day 2-3)

🔧 Basic Operation:

  • Connect to air supply at minimum operating pressure
  • Verify smooth operation through full stroke
  • Check for binding, sticking, or rough spots
  • Test at maximum operating pressure
  • Verify force output (if possible to measure)

🔧 Leak Testing:

  • Pressurize and hold for 5 minutes
  • Check all ports and seals for leakage
  • Use soap solution to detect small leaks
  • Verify internal sealing (no pressure loss)

Phase 4: Installation Trials (Day 3-5)

🔩 Fit and Compatibility:

  • Test-fit in actual mounting location
  • Verify port accessibility for connections
  • Check clearances and interference
  • Confirm sensor mounting (if applicable)
  • Test with your actual fittings and hoses

Phase 5: Performance Testing (Week 1-2)

⚡ Operating Conditions:

  • Run at actual operating pressure and cycle rate
  • Monitor for temperature rise
  • Check for noise or vibration
  • Verify speed meets requirements
  • Test under loaded conditions if possible

Phase 6: Accelerated Life Testing (Week 2-4)

📊 Durability Validation:

  • Run continuous cycles (10,000-100,000+)
  • Periodically check for wear, leakage, performance degradation
  • Monitor seal condition
  • Document any changes in operation
  • Compare to manufacturer’s cycle life claims

Advanced Testing (For Critical Applications)

Material Analysis:

  • Seal material identification (FTIR spectroscopy4)
  • Metal composition verification (XRF analysis5)
  • Hardness testing of critical components
  • Coating thickness measurement

Environmental Testing:

  • Temperature cycling (if applicable to your environment)
  • Humidity exposure
  • Chemical compatibility (with your actual media)
  • Contamination resistance

Documentation and Reporting

Create a comprehensive evaluation report:

  1. Test Summary: Pass/fail for each test category
  2. Dimensional Data: Measured vs. specified with deviations
  3. Performance Metrics: Actual vs. claimed performance
  4. Photos: Document condition, any issues found
  5. Recommendations: Approve for bulk order, request modifications, or reject

How long should I allow for sample evaluation before making a bulk order decision?

Allow 3-4 weeks for comprehensive sample evaluation: 1 week for shipping and initial inspection, 1-2 weeks for installation trials and performance testing, and 1 week for accelerated life testing and documentation review. For critical applications requiring extensive testing (100,000+ cycles, environmental exposure, third-party analysis), allow 6-8 weeks.
